Responsibilities:

  • Operate the established portfolio governance framework, including intake, prioritization, investment planning, decision forums, and escalation of cross-initiative dependencies and tradeoffs, ensuring portfolio priorities and delivery decisionsremainaligned to enterprise businessobjectives, regulatory commitments, and strategic value drivers.

  • Own portfolio performance management, including tracking and reporting KPIs such as delivery predictability, budget adherence, resource capacityutilization, change trends, ROI, and value realization, and translating portfolio data into clear, executive-ready insights and recommendations to supporttimelydecision-making.

  • Ensure consistent application of project and program management disciplines across scope, schedule, financial planning, risk, issue, and change management, while reinforcing PMO standards, reporting artifacts, and performance benchmarks to improve delivery maturity and predictability.

  • Govern delivery execution by monitoring adherence to approved delivery plans, integrated schedules, QA/QC standards, and vendor performance across initiatives, and coaching delivery leads and project managers on execution discipline, risk mitigation, and stakeholder engagement.

  • Provide end-to-end delivery governance across the implementation lifecycle, from requirements and solution design through build, testing, go-live,hypercare, and project closure, across waterfall, agile, and hybrid delivery methodologies.

  • Identifydeliverybottlenecks, systemic risks, and performance gaps, and drive corrective actions in partnership with delivery, technology, and business leaders,applystructured riskassessmentsand change management principles asappropriate.

  • Partner with Change Management to integrate stakeholder impacts, communications, training, change readiness, adoption metrics, and lessons learned into portfolio execution, ensuring solutions achieve intended business outcomes and sustained adoption.

  • Support Digital/ITfinancial management, including annual budgeting, forecasting, capitalization/OPEX tracking, and portfolio-level variance management in partnership with Finance, with an understanding of how investment decisions impact long-term financial performance.

  • Produceexecutive-ready portfolio insights and recommendations, reinforcing a culture of accountability, transparency, and continuous improvement, and serving as a trusted advisor to senior leaders on delivery health, tradeoffs, and improvement opportunities.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in business, engineering, computer science, ora relatedfield (or equivalent experience).

  • 8-10 years of experience in project, program, or portfolio management within complex digital or technology environments.

  • Demonstrated experienceoperatingand governing enterprise PMO frameworks (not just standing them up).

  • Proven success managing cross-functional portfolios in matrixed, regulated, or asset-intensive organizations.

  • PMP,PgMP, PMI-ACP,SAFe, or equivalent certifications.

  • Strong portfolio governance and performance management capability.

  • Financial acumen (budgeting, forecasting, capitalization, variance management)

  • Executive communication and decision-support skills.

  • Ability to influence without authority and drive disciplined execution.

  • Strong facilitation, problem-solving, and operational leadership skills.

  • Resilience and adaptability in complex, multi-stakeholder environments.
